The population in Douglassville is 348. There are 55 people per square mile aka population density. The median age in Douglassville is 36.8, the US median age is 38.4. The number of people per household in Douglassville is 1.7, the US average of people per household is 2.6.
Family in Douglassville
- 56.1% are married
- 28.3% are divorced
- 5.7% are married with children
- 25.7% have children, but are single
Race in Douglassville
- 72.5% are White
- 27.5% are Black
- 0.0% are Asian
- 0.0% are Native American
- 0.0% claim Other
- 0.0% claim Hispanic ethnicity
- 0.0% Two or more races
- 0.0% Hawaiian, Pacific Islander
